The 2026 Hyundai IONIQ 9 emerges as a significant contender in the three-row electric SUV segment, impressing with its spaciousness, advanced technology, and premium interior appointments that rival luxury brands. The reviewer highlights its superior aerodynamics, contributing to an estimated range of over 335 miles (540 km), and praises the comfortable ride quality and quiet cabin, even on rough roads. Key advantages include its substantial cargo capacity, exceeding that of the Kia EV9, and a futuristic interior featuring high-quality faux leather and a versatile sliding console. The performance variant, with dual 160kW motors, offers brisk acceleration (0-60 mph under 5 seconds) while maintaining impressive efficiency. Criticisms are minimal, with the reviewer noting the navigation system can be overly thorough and expressing a desire for digital side mirrors in the North American market. The vehicle's pricing, estimated to start around $47,000 USD equivalent in Korea, positions it as a compelling value proposition against more expensive luxury EVs like the Volvo EX90.
